Draft. An unclear amber beer with a huge orangey head. The aroma has notes of malt, caramel, and fruit. The flavor is sweet with notes of malt, caramel, and rose hips, as well as a light note of honey, leading to a dry spicy finish.

Draught @ Bryggeriet Apollo, Vesterbrogade 3, 1620 Copenhagen, Denmark.Unclear medium red amber color with a average, frothy to creamy, good lacing, mostly lasting, off-white to beige head. Aroma is moderate malty, grain - caramel, berry - rosehip. Flavor is moderate to light heavy sweet and bitter with a average to long duration, fruity, nutty.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is soft. [20101023]

On tap. Pours a hazy dark amber with a small and dense off-white head. Sweetish fruity nose with a little caramel also. Medium body, very sweet malt and caramel with a wee whiff of yeast. Comes off fairly perfumy - probably from the rose hips. Has some light phenols and a whiff of hops in the finish. 141010

From tap at the brewpub. Pours hazy and hazzlenut brown with a small off-white head. Aroma is fruity and slight citric. Light yeasty. Roasted caramelish malt. Slight citric and herbal. Mellow fruity. Lingering malty and fruity finish.
